| Canonical Smiles | CC(C)(C)C1=CC=C(C=C1)C(=O)N |
| IUPAC Name | 4-tert-butylbenzamide |
| InChIKey | VIPMBJSGYWWHAO-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| INCHI | 1S/C11H15NO/c1-11(2,3)9-6-4-8(5-7-9)10(12)13/h4-7H,1-3H3,(H2,12,13) |
| Isomeric SMILES | CC(C)(C)C1=CC=C(C=C1)C(=O)N |
| PubChem CID | 92014 |
| Molecular Weight | 177.25 |

| Melt Point(°C) | 171-175 °C |
|---|---|
| Molecular Weight | 177.240 g/mol |
| XLogP3 | 2.500 |
| Hydrogen Bond Donor Count | 1 |
|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count | 1 |
| Rotatable Bond Count | 2 |
| Exact Mass | 177.115 Da |
| Monoisotopic Mass | 177.115 Da |
| Topological Polar Surface Area | 43.100 Ų |
| Heavy Atom Count | 13 |
| Formal Charge | 0 |
| Complexity | 185.000 |
| Isotope Atom Count | 0 |
| Defined Atom Stereocenter Count | 0 |
| Undefined Atom Stereocenter Count | 0 |
| Defined Bond Stereocenter Count | 0 |
| Undefined Bond Stereocenter Count | 0 |
| The total count of all stereochemical bonds | 0 |
| Covalently-Bonded Unit Count | 1 |
